Staff Software Engineer - Full Stack

A self-serve advertising platform specializing in multi-channel solutions including native, display, video, connected TV, and digital ads.
Canada
Frontend
Staff Software Engineer
Remote
6+ years of experience
Advertising · Enterprise SaaS

Description For Staff Software Engineer - Full Stack

StackAdapt is seeking a Staff Software Engineer to lead their full-stack engineering team in their Audiences & CDP domain. This role is part of their Platform Engineering team, focusing on building and scaling their advertising platform that serves thousands of digitally-focused companies. The position involves working with modern tech stacks including GoLang, Ruby on Rails, React, and GraphQL, handling large datasets, and contributing to a diverse and flexible engineering culture. The Audiences team's mission is to enable marketers to achieve their goals through building powerful workflows for audience targeting and conversion journey data. As a Staff Engineer, you'll be responsible for making critical technical decisions, mentoring team members, architecting scalable solutions, and driving engineering excellence. The role offers comprehensive benefits, including competitive compensation, retirement matching, flexible work arrangements, and various personal development opportunities. StackAdapt has been recognized for its workplace culture, receiving awards such as Ad Age Best Places to Work 2024 and being named among the Best Workplaces for Women.

Last updated a day ago

Responsibilities For Staff Software Engineer - Full Stack

  • Advise on full-stack technical decisions for the Audiences & CDP domain
  • Unpack ambiguity and complexity and delegate work for greenfield initiatives
  • Communicate complex technical endeavors both verbally and in technical design documents
  • Architect scalable web APIs, component libraries and backend systems
  • Collaborate with stakeholders to solve technical challenges
  • Mentor the team and lead by example
  • Conduct technical interviews
  • Identify and solve system-wide performance issues
  • Be a significant individual contributor in critical projects

Requirements For Staff Software Engineer - Full Stack

React
TypeScript
Ruby
Go
  • 6+ years of experience building highly performant web applications
  • Knowledge of React, Typescript, GraphQL, Ruby on Rails and Go
  • Experience with test driven development
  • Experience working with relational databases and key-value stores
  • Experience analyzing and optimizing web application performance
  • Experience leading large scale modernization efforts
  • Experience collaborating with Product & Design teams

Benefits For Staff Software Engineer - Full Stack

401k
Medical Insurance
Dental Insurance
Vision Insurance
Mental Health Assistance
Parental Leave
Education Budget
  • Highly competitive salary
  • RRSP/401K matching
  • 3 weeks vacation + 3 personal care days + 1 Culture & Belief day + birthdays off
  • Comprehensive mental health care platform
  • Full benefits from day one
  • Work from home reimbursements
  • Optional global WeWork membership
  • Personal development coverage
  • Parental leave policy
  • Team social events

Interested in this job?

Jobs Related To StackAdapt Staff Software Engineer - Full Stack

Staff Software Engineer - Full Stack

Lead full-stack development for LinkedIn's DataHub platform, architecting solutions for data discovery and governance while mentoring engineers and driving technical innovation.

Staff Software Engineer - Full Stack

Lead full-stack development for LinkedIn's DataHub platform, architecting solutions for data discovery and governance while mentoring team members and driving technical innovation.

Staff Web Software Engineer, Curation Foundations

Lead frontend engineering initiatives at Pinterest as a Staff Web Software Engineer, developing engaging features using React/Redux while mentoring teams and driving technical solutions.

Hiring a Founding Typescript Engineer to build a modern Firebase

Founding Typescript Engineer position at Instant, building next-generation database technology for real-time collaborative applications.

Lead Full-Stack Engineer

Lead Full-Stack Engineer position at Roame, building next-gen flight search engine for credit card points redemption